The cheapest way to get from Pietrasanta to San Miniato is to train which costs €9 - €16 and takes 1h 35m.
The fastest way to get from Pietrasanta to San Miniato is to drive which takes 1h 5m and costs €11 - €16.
No, there is no direct train from Pietrasanta to San Miniato. However, there are services departing from Pietrasanta and arriving at S. Miniato-Fucecchio via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 35m.
The distance between Pietrasanta and San Miniato is 72 km. The road distance is 70.2 km.
The best way to get from Pietrasanta to San Miniato without a car is to train which takes 1h 35m and costs €9 - €16.
It takes approximately 1h 35m to get from Pietrasanta to San Miniato, including transfers.
Pietrasanta to San Miniato train services, operated by Trenitalia, depart from Pietrasanta station.
Pietrasanta to San Miniato train services, operated by Trenitalia, arrive at S. Miniato-Fucecchio station.
Yes, the driving distance between Pietrasanta to San Miniato is 70 km. It takes approximately 1h 5m to drive from Pietrasanta to San Miniato.
